Treatment The target of treatment is to attenuate pain, gradual the development of damage, and preserve or develop muscle mass mass. Treatment is realized with a combination of therapies, which may involve any of the subsequent: Life style improvements: Fat Management Minimal-impact things to do, for instance leash walks or swimming Usage of non-slip rugs and ramps to obtain on beds, couches or cars Physical rehabilitation: Underwater treadmill Selection of motion routines or other Home Page therapeutic modalities — together with acupuncture, LASER therapy plus much more Pain management: NSAIDs (n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ory medicine) are commonly prescribed prescription drugs to handle OA pain and inflammation. Your Doggy will require program checking with blood operate whenever they involve lengthy-term NSAIDs. More medicines, such as gabapentin and amantadine, could be presented together with NSAIDs. Librela (bedinvetmab) is often a type of injectable medication called a monoclonal antibody which might be given after month to month to provide longer-time period control of OA pain. It targets a selected driver of OA pain called nerve growth element (NGF). Joint support: Supplements, which include glucosamine and chondroitin sulfate, and omega-three fatty acids Joint injections, including platelet-abundant plasma, stem mobile therapy or RSO (radiosynoviorthesis or model title Synovetin OA) Surgery: May be recommended for many circumstances which have underlying causes of OA, including hip dysplasia, cranial cruciate ligament rupture and elbow dysplasia, between others Final result OA causes progressive harm to afflicted joints, as well as prognosis may differ dependant upon the fundamental cause and severity. While there isn't a heal for OA, there are lots of techniques to deal with pain and hold off its development, making it possible for several dogs to Stay comfortably having a multimodal approach to treatment. The earlier OA is diagnosed and managed ahead of the serious progression of OA, the greater the very long-phrase end result. Picture delivered.
